122 Main Street, Lower Largo is a Grade C listed building in the Fife local planning authority area, Scotland. First listed on 1 March 1984.

Description
This is a mid-18th century building on Main Street, Lower Largo, situated with a group value alongside 119 and 121 Main Street. The building is two storeys high, with a single-storey section to the north. It has three wide bays and is harled with painted window reveals. The south elevation features an off-centre doorway and a symmetrical arrangement of windows: three windows on the ground floor and three on the first floor. Some original 12-pane sash windows remain. The north elevation has a central crowstepped gable to the north-east, and end stacks. The roof is covered with pantiles.
